Enabling Data-Based Decision Making in Education: A Systematic Review of Leadership, Culture, and Capacity Challenges

Data-Based Decision Making (DBDM) has become an important strategy in modern education reform that emphasizes the use of empirical information to improve the quality of learning processes and outcomes. This literature reviews 30 international scientific articles that explore various aspects of DBDM implementation in schools, including the role of leadership, data team collaboration, instrument validity, information technology integration, and application in the context of inclusive education. Thematic analysis shows that the success of DBDM implementation is largely determined by the capacity of school leadership in building a data-driven culture, teachers' ability to interpret and use data, and systemic support through technology and ongoing training. Studies highlight the importance of transformational leadership and collaborative data team structures. Meanwhile, the development of instruments such as the has proven valid in measuring school readiness and capability to implement DBDM. The identified barriers include limited data literacy, inadequate infrastructure, and cultural resistance to evaluative practices. Thus, this literature confirms that DBDM requires comprehensive support in terms of policy, resources, and strengthening individual capacity to be implemented sustainably and have an impact on improving the quality of education.
